NEUROSCIENCE: Hippocampal Cells Help Rats Think Ahead
Karen Heyman
In the 7 November issue of The Journal of Neuroscience, neuroscientists use electrodes implanted into the brains of rats to capture, on the scale of single neurons, rodents thinking ahead about their routes in a maze.
